    Lucy is a vicious wench and the only villain in the whole Peanuts gang. I think most of you are looking at this piece as an art toy or adaptation of English's work. I've come to realize that this way of thinking is foolish.

    The whole piece is obviously an attack on the Lucy character herself, whose self-importance and strong will led her to dominate her peers with ruthless enthusiasm. By grotesquely stripping her down to this form, English exposes Charlie Brown's nemesis and makes this villain vulnerable and ridiculed. We've all felt like the underdog at least a few times on the playground during childhood, now as an adult Charlie-Brown/English takes his revenge on the bullying manipulator. This manipulator is a common children's character, inflicting trauma while also inspiring the victim to desire the acceptance of the bully who reigns on the playground hierarchy. Why did Charlie Brown always fall for the old football kick gag? Because he needed the Alpha Child's acceptance. Here, Lucy is the one abused.

    Also worth noting is that the sexualization to the point of absurdity references the embedded misogyny that C Schultz's placed within the core of the Lucy character.
